Variable resistors, also known as potentiometers or rheostats, are essential components in electronic circuits that allow for the adjustment of resistance levels. These devices are used in a wide range of applications, from volume controls in audio equipment to speed controls in motors. As technology continues to advance, the manufacturing processes for variable resistors have also evolved to meet the demands of modern electronics.One of the latest manufacturing processes for variable resistors is the use of thin film technology. Thin film resistors are created by depositing a thin layer of resistive material onto a substrate, such as ceramic or glass. This process allows for precise control over the resistance value and provides excellent stability and reliability. Thin film resistors are commonly used in high-precision applications where accuracy is critical, such as in medical devices and aerospace equipment.Another advanced manufacturing process for variable resistors is the use of thick film technology. Thick film resistors are created by screen printing a resistive paste onto a substrate and then firing it at high temperatures to form a thick, durable film. This process is more cost-effective than thin film technology and is suitable for high-volume production. Thick film resistors are commonly used in consumer electronics, automotive applications, and industrial control systems.In addition to thin film and thick film technologies, another emerging manufacturing process for variable resistors is the use of semiconductor materials. Semiconductor resistors are created by doping a semiconductor material, such as silicon or germanium, to create a variable resistance element. This process allows for precise control over the resistance value and provides excellent temperature stability. Inductors mainly play the role of filtering, oscillation, delay, notch, etc. in the circuit, as well as screening signals, filtering noise, stabilizing current and suppressing electromagnetic wave interference.   The structure of inductor is similar to that of transformer, but there is only one winding, which is generally composed of skeleton, winding, shielding cover, packaging material, magnetic core or iron core, etc. If the inductor is in the state of no current passing, it will try to prevent the current from flowing through it when the circuit is connected; If the inductor is in a state of current flow, it will try to maintain the current when the circuit is disconnected.   The inductor is composed of coils surrounded by magnetic materials. When the current passes through the inductor, it will create a magnetic field, which does not like to be changed. Therefore, an inductor is an element that will prevent the current flowing through it from changing; If the current flowing through the inductor is constant, the inductor will feel very comfortable and will not create additional force on the charged particles flowing through it. In this case, the inductor behaves like a normal wire.   However, if we try to block the current flowing through the inductor, the inductor will create a force to maintain the current flowing through the inductor. If an inductor is connected end to end, and the circuit has no other resistance, in theory, the current can flow forever without decay.   However, unless we use superconductors, any wire itself has resistance, which will cause the final current to decay to zero. The greater the resistance in the circuit, the faster the current decay; However, the larger the inductance of the inductor, the slower the current will decay. Once the current decays to zero, the inductor will try to maintain the current status of zero; This is because the inductor always tries to stop the current flowing through it from changing.   Therefore, when we connect the inductor to a circuit, at first, the inductor will generate a force, which will prevent the current from increasing.
